Course Details

Introduction to Regulatory Affairs for Telemedicine: Understanding the regulatory landscape, key stakeholders, and the importance of compliance in telemedicine.
Telemedicine Modalities and Associated Regulations: Exploring various telemedicine modalities (synchronous, asynchronous, and remote patient monitoring) and their specific regulatory requirements.
Legal and Ethical Considerations in Telemedicine: Examining legal frameworks, ethical principles, and best practices in telemedicine, including patient privacy, informed consent, and malpractice liability.
Clinical Guidelines and Standards for Telemedicine: Reviewing evidence-based clinical guidelines and standards for telemedicine practice, ensuring safe and effective patient care.
Clinical Trials and Research in Telemedicine: Understanding the regulatory and ethical considerations for conducting clinical trials and research in the telemedicine sector.
Prescribing and Dispensing Medications through Telemedicine: Investigating regulations related to prescribing and dispensing medications remotely, including controlled substances.
Interstate and Cross-Border Telemedicine Practices: Navigating the complexities of interstate and cross-border telemedicine, including licensure, credentialing, and jurisdictional issues.
Quality Assurance and Performance Improvement in Telemedicine: Implementing quality assurance programs, continuous improvement strategies, and performance measurement techniques to maintain regulatory compliance and ensure high-quality patient care.
Emerging Trends and Future Directions in Telemedicine Regulation: Anticipating and adapting to emerging trends, technologies, and regulatory developments affecting the telemedicine sector.

The Regulatory Affairs Specialist role is the most in-demand, with 50% of job opportunities in the sector. These professionals are responsible for ensuring that telemedicine platforms and devices meet regulatory standards and requirements. They work closely with product development teams, legal counsel, and other stakeholders to ensure compliance with national and international regulations. Compliance Officers account for 30% of job opportunities in the telemedicine regulatory affairs sector. They are responsible for monitoring and enforcing compliance with laws and regulations governing telemedicine services. This role requires a strong understanding of the legal and regulatory landscape, as well as the ability to work collaboratively with cross-functional teams to address compliance issues and implement corrective actions. Telemedicine Consultants make up the remaining 20% of job opportunities in the sector. These professionals provide guidance and expertise to healthcare organizations and telemedicine service providers on best practices for delivering high-quality care while maintaining compliance with regulations. They may also be involved in developing and implementing telemedicine programs, as well as training and educating healthcare professionals on telemedicine best practices.
